SERVICE-ORIENTED DESIGN: A MULTI-VIEWPOINT APPROACH
- 1 December 2004
- journal article
- research article
- Published by World Scientific Pub Co Pte Ltd in International Journal of Cooperative Information Systems
- Vol. 13 (04) , 337-368
- https://doi.org/10.1142/s0218843004001012
Abstract
As the technology associated with the "Web Services" trend gains significant adoption, the need for a corresponding design approach becomes increasingly important. This paper introduces a foundational model for designing (composite) services. The innovation of this model lies in the identification of four interrelated viewpoints (interface behaviour, provider behaviour, choreography, and orchestration) and their formalization from a control-flow perspective in terms of Petri nets. By formally capturing the interrelationships between these viewpoints, the proposal enables the static verification of the consistency of composite services designed in a cooperative and incremental manner. A proof-of-concept simulation and verification tool has been developed to test the possibilities of the proposed model.Keywords
This publication has 16 references indexed in Scilit:
- Web services orchestration and choreographyComputer, 2003
- Conceptual Modeling of Web Service ConversationsPublished by Springer Nature ,2003
- The Self-Serv environment for Web services compositionIEEE Internet Computing, 2003
- Compatibility of e-Services in a Cooperative Multi-platfrom EnvironmentPublished by Springer Nature ,2001
- Dynamic and adaptive composition of e-servicesInformation Systems, 2001
- The Linear Time - Branching Time Spectrum I. The Semantics of Concrete, Sequential ProcessesPublished by Elsevier ,2001
- On the role of basic design concepts in behaviour structuringComputer Networks and ISDN Systems, 1997
- Branching time and abstraction in bisimulation semanticsJournal of the ACM, 1996
- Causal behaviours and netsPublished by Springer Nature ,1995
- Parallel complexity in the design and analysis of concurrent systemsPublished by Springer Nature ,1991